Perfect Fit!
I purchase two of these rain covers - a 35L and a 45L. Both covers fit my bags perfectly, based on the dimensions of my bags vs the product dimensions as advertised. I did not go by the liter capacity, but by the dimensions. Combine perfect fit with a good price and I am a satisfied customer. One note on the fit...one of my bags has shoulder straps that begin on the top of the bag. The cover slips down just a bit under load, as you would expect, and thus just a little water may get to the top of the bag. The other bag has straps that begin just below the top of the bag. This cover cinches down perfectly and stays in place.

just a little small for a 35L pack ...
The raincover is just a little small for a 35L pack in that it dosen't come all the way over the top or bottom, which also makes it a little prone to coming off if you are bushwacking or in high winds. I had to add a little duct tape and small grommet on mine to keep it clipped to my pack so it would stay on the top. Its very lightweight and packable but just not enough coverage and the top of my pack, and sides got wet in the first rainstorm. This couild be a good cover with just a bit of change to help keep it on the pack, and if it was about 10-15% larger.
